What's nextstep?
If you are interested in learning more about Central or have been attending and want to join our community, nextstep is for you. With nextstep, we have designed a brief small group experience to engage and connect you with our leaders and community. This is a time for you to ask questions and grow in your understanding of our history and structure.
nextstep is encouraged for new members and provides you the opportunity to join with us in your faith journey by becoming a member of our community. We really do feel that life is better connected and think that nextstep is a great way for us to connect with one another.

The free-will offering will help support the Music for Life Institute. The African Children’s Choir
has been Music for Life’s major international program during its 34 year history. Music for Life
(MFL) has relief and development programs in seven African countries. MFL has currently
educated over 52,000 children and hundreds of thousands of lives have been impacted by their
international relief and development programs. Don’t miss out on this uniquely immersive worship experience through song, dance and video story-telling!
